A search operation is currently underway in the Central West after a vehicle was swept into a flooded causeway overnight.
On the back of a deluge of rain across the region, at about 6.30pm on Thursday, emergency services were called to Macdonalds Creek, near Lower Piambong Road, Erudgere - about 15km north-west of Mudgee - after reports a vehicle had been swept into a causeway by floodwaters.
Officers attached to Orana-Mid Western Police District, assisted by Fire and Rescue NSW and NSW SES, commenced a search and rescue operation and located a vehicle submerged in the waterway; it's unknown if there are any persons inside the vehicle at this time.
Police and emergency services will continue operations this morning to access the vehicle.
